Neighbors in Action: Islamic Center of East Lansing

Courtesy photo

The Islamic Center of East Lansing was one of several places across the country to receive a hate letter last week. They responded with a respectful reply. For Neighbors in Action, we speak to Dr. Abdalmajid Katranji and Farah Khalil of the Islamic Center to find out what opportunities they have to learn and to volunteer.

Since the election, there have been incidents of hatred against marginalized groups, and the Lansing area has not been immune. Last week, a hate letter was sent to Muslim organizations across the country, including the Islamic Center of East Lansing. It said things like Muslims are evil and Trump is going to deport you, among other things.

The Islamic Center wrote a peaceful, public reply to the letter. Representatives of the Center say that the hate letter does not reflect the Lansing community, which has always been very supportive and positive.

For Neighbors in Action, we talk with Dr. Abdalmajid Katranji and Farah Khalil of the Islamic Center.
